Description

Lost Cities by the world-renowned board-game author Reiner Knizia takes you on a journey to undiscovered countries and mythical places. Compete against a friend, a stranger or one of 4 different computer players, in what has been called a "two player Solitaire with an extra portion of suspense". Designed and polished for the iPhone by TheCodingMonkeys, makers of Carcassonne for iOS.
• online matches against game center friends
• voice acted interactive tutorial
• comprehensive rules section
• 4 different AI players with emotions
• full-length atmospheric soundtrack
• a plethora of single- and multiplayer achievements
• fully playable via VoiceOver
